The 8-OHdG (8-hydroxydeoxyguanosine) ELISA Kit is specifically designed for the accurate quantification of 8-OHdG levels in biological samples such as urine, plasma, serum, and tissue homogenates. This kit offers high sensitivity and specificity, ensuring precise and reproducible results for various research applications.8-OHdG is a well-known marker of oxidative DNA damage and is commonly used in studying oxidative stress-related diseases such as cancer, cardiovascular diseases, and aging. By accurately measuring 8-OHdG levels, researchers can gain valuable insights into the pathogenesis of these diseases and potentially develop novel therapeutic strategies. Overall, the 8-OHdG ELISA Kit provides researchers with a powerful tool for investigating oxidative stress, biomarker discovery, and drug development in a reliable and efficient manner.

This ELISA kit uses the Competitive-ELISA principle. The micro ELISA plate provided in this kit has been pre-coated with the target antigen. Standards or samples are added along with a biotinylated detection antibody. The target antigen present in the sample competes with the immobilized antigen for binding to the detection antibody. After incubation, Avidin-Horseradish Peroxidase (HRP) conjugate is added. Free components are washed away. The substrate solution is then added, resulting in a color change. The intensity of the color is inversely proportional to the concentration of the target antigen in the sample. The reaction is stopped by the addition of stop solution, and the color changes from blue to yellow. The optical density (OD) is measured at 450 nm ± 2 nm. The concentration of the target protein is calculated by comparing the OD values of the samples to the standard curve.
